No. 582. An Act to provide for the punishment of all persons who
aid minors in obtaining intoxicating liquors from inn keepers
and other persons engaged in the sale of the same, and also to
provide for the punishment of minors who falsely represent
themselves to be twenty-one years of age or over, in order to
obtain intoxicating liquors from inn keepers or others engaged

1140

in the sale of same............................................
No. 583. An Act to authorize the Mayor and City Council of Laurel,
Prince George's county, to levy an additional tax in the said

1141

town of Laurel if found necessary ............................
No. 584. An Act to repeal and re-enact with amendments Chapter
237 of the Acts of the General Assembly of Maryland of 1896,

1142

title " Cecil County," sub-title " Birds and Game."..............
No. 585. An Act to, repeal Sections 2, 13, 14 A, 15 1/2 and 16 of Chap-
ter 179 of the Acts of 1902, and to be re-enacted so as to read as

1142

follows :.....................................................
No. 586. An Act to repeal and re-enact with amendments Section
99 of "Article 6 of the Code of Public Local Laws, title " Caro-
line County," sub-title " Denton," as said section was repealed

1143

and re-enacted by Chapter 447 of the Acts of 1902 .............
No. 587. An Act to repeal Section 1 of Article 1 of the Code of
Public Local Laws, entitled " Allegany County." sub-title

1144

" Almshouse," and to re-enact the same with amendments......
No. 588. An Act to incorporate the Kensington Electric Light and

1145

Water Company of Kensington, Montgomery, Maryland .......
No. 589. An Act to repeal and re-enact with amendments Sections
79 and 80 of Article 2 of the Code of Public Local Laws, title
"Anne Arundel County," sub-title "Birds, Game and Foxes,"
as enacted by Chapter 79 of the Acts of 1904, and to add a new

1146

section to said article, to be known as Section 80 A..............
No. 590. An Act to provide for an additional Justice of the Peace

1149

for the Seventh Election District of Montgomery county .......
No. 591. An Act to authorize Hugh T. Bay, Register of Wills of
Harford county, to make a cornple index of the wills now on
record in the Orphans' Court for Harford County, and to pro-

1151

vide for the payment thereof..................................
No. 703. An Act to repeal and re-enact with amendments Section
24 of Article 33 of the Code of Public General Laws of Maryland,
title "Elections," as amended by Chapter 254 of the Acts of the

1152,

General Assembly of Maryland, passed at the Session of 1904...
No. 704. An Act to repeal and re-enact with amendments Section
425 of Article 27 of the Code, of Public General Laws of Mary-
land, title " Crimes and Punishments," sub-title "Vagrants and

1152

Tramps ".............................................. .....
No. 705. An Act to amend Article 1 of the Code of Public Local
Laws of Maryland, entitled "Allegany County," sub-title
" Cumberland," by adding four new sections thereto, which pro-
vide for the appointment of a certified public accountant for
the city of Cumberland, and prescribes his duties and fixes his
compensation ; said new sections to be known as 79 J, 79 K,

1154

79 L and 79 M ...................... .........................
